华为云的分布式数据库主要指的是华为云提供的GaussDB(D)和GaussDB(T)等产品。分布式数据库是一种跨多个节点或位置分散存储和管理数据的数据库系统,以提高数据的可靠性、可扩展性和可用性。下面将概述一些关键特点:
- 高可用性和可靠性:分布式数据库在多个物理位置复制数据,即使一个或多个节点失败也能保证服务不中断,提高数据安全性。
- 水平扩展性(Scalability):与传统的关系数据库系统相比,分布式数据库可以通过增加更多的节点来轻松扩展系统的数据存储能力和计算能力,这对处理大规模数据和高并发请求尤其重要。
- 弹性伸缩:分布式数据库支持根据实际业务需求动态调整资源,进行上下扩展,以优化资源使用效率和成本。
- 容错能力:通过数据的多副本和分区,以及复制策略,即使部分节点发生故障,也能保障数据库服务的持续可用性和数据的完整性。
- 数据一致性:分布式数据库通过各种一致性协议(如Paxos、Raft等)保证数据在多个副本之间的一致性,尽管在一些情况下可能需要在一致性和性能之间做权衡(CAP定理)。
- 地理分布:分布式数据库可以在不同地理位置部署,有助于数据本地化管理,减少数据访问延迟,同时遵守当地数据保护法规。
- 独立的计算与存储:在某些分布式数据库架构中,计算和存储可以独立扩展,提供更大的灵活性和成本效益。
- 自动化运维:华为云的分布式数据库通常提供简化的管理和运维工具,支持自动化的灾备、备份、恢复和性能优化功能。
华为云的分布式数据库产品如GaussDB(D)具体还会根据不同的应用场景提供特异性的优势和特性,如特殊的数据模型支持、机器学习集成功能等,以满足不同行业和企业的需求。对于企业而言,选择适合自己业务需求的分布式数据库产品和解决方案是提高系统性能和业务竞争力的关键因素之一。
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/176364.html